Interpoliertes Volumen

Allgemeine Beschreibung

Generischer Interpolationsparameter, der einen Wert zurückgibt, der auf dem aktuellen Volumen (Zeitschritt) eines Reservoirs oder eines Storage-Knotens basiert. Der

parameter verwendet eine Reihe (Tabelle) von Volumen des Reservoirs und entsprechende Werte. In diesem Fall sind die zugehörigen Werte die entsprechenden Gebiet des Stausees für eine bestimmte Volumen.

Interpolation wird verwendet, um Werte zwischen Punkten zu berechnen, die im Interpolationsfeld angegeben sind. API Referenz

Attribute

Name
Beschreibung
Erforderlich

Art

interpoliertes Volumen

Ja

Knoten

Storage node um Eingabevolumenwerte für die Interpolationsberechnung bereitzustellen

Ja

Volumina

x-Koordinaten der Datenpunkte für die Interpolation

Ja

Werte

y-Koordinaten der Datenpunkte für die Interpolation

Ja

interp_kwargs

Wörterbuch der Schlüsselwortargumente, an die übergeben werden soll scipy.interpolate.interp1d Klasse und wird für die Interpolation verwendet

Fakultativ

Beispiel

Das folgende Json zeigt ein Beispiel für eine Härtung mit der Bewertung von Fläche und Volumen für ein Reservoir. Dies könnte verwendet werden, um das Area-Attribut eines Speicher- oder Reservoir-Knotens zu definieren.

{
  „type“: „InterpolatedVolumeParameter“,
  „node“: „Reservoir oder Storage node Name“,
	„Bände“: [
		0,
		7,
		10,
		15,
		25
	],
	„Werte“: [
		1,
		2,
		4,
		6,
		14
	],

	„interp_kwargs“: {
		„kind“: „linear“
	},
  „Kommentar“: „Volumen: Mm3, Werte: Km2"
}

Das Json steht für die folgende Tabelle:

Volumen (Mm3)
Fläche (Km2)

0

1

7

2

10

4

15

6

25

14

Wenn es geplottet ist, sieht es so aus:

Unten finden Sie ein Beispiel für eine Gebietsbewertungstabelle

Volumen (Mm3)
Fläche (Km2)

0

1

7

2

10

4

15

6

25

14

Wenn es geplottet ist, sieht es so aus

Last updated